Today I would like to talk about an initiative I support call United24. This initiative was launched by the President of Ukraine, Volodymyr Zelenskyy, and is the official Ukrainian government means of collecting donations in support of Ukraine. It has some fairly high profile proponents also.
There are three areas you can donate towards - defence and demining, medical aid and rebuilding Ukraine. There is also an initiative to assemble an army of drones. You can contribute to this either by money or by donating your own drone if it has the required specifications. The drone army is used for reconnaissance of enemy positions.
